Answer to Question 1

c
RATIONALE: The U.S. Internal Revenue Service uses data mining to identify patterns that distinguish questionable annual personal income tax filings.

Answer to Question 2

a
RATIONALE: The light bulb manufacturer has successfully used descriptive analytics to present the status of its supply chain to managers visually.
